Police said Wednesday (Oct. 20) they have two suspects in the attack that left a bodyguard for Kurupt dead and two others injured outside a recording studio Sunday night. Detective Jose Carrillo said police also believe they know why the attack, in which 23-year-old Dwayne Dupree was shot several times in the chest, occurred, despite a lack of cooperation from eyewitnesses. He would not say what that motive was. The suspects are two black males, though more gunmen could have been involved in the attack, the detective said. Carrillo said he did not sense from speaking to witnesses that any of them were fearful before the attack. But he added, "Unfortunately, we're dealing with uncooperative witnesses." He would not say whether Kurupt witnessed the incident. Police spoke to Kurupt at the crime scene, said Carrillo, who declined to discuss the rapper's statements.

DPGs Shot At. Tha Realest Shot. Bodygaurd Dead

Mtv.com reports that Daz & Kurupt were shot at in their studios last night at 11:40 pm. Their bodygaurd Dwayne "Draws" Dupree was killed from multiple gun shots. Jevon Jones better known to us as "Tha Realest" yes the one from Death Row was shot and is ok in the hospital right now. Willard "Act Da Fool" Givers was also shot and is doing well.
